I have a problem with returning errors. In a function like
serverValidateusing ZOD, all variables might be valid, but later in theactionfunction I send a database query to subscribe an email to the newsletter. If that email already exists, I want to return an error for that field saying that this email already exists.Is there a good practice for this? Should the error formats match those from ZOD? Does
tanstack/react-formhave any helper function to prepare such an error?I prepared an example: https://codesandbox.io/p/devbox/boring-hoover-sjlvcc
The only solution I came up with is returning something like ServerFormState in this case, or for example throw new ServerValidateError. But then it`s tricky to handle the types properly. Is there any other approach for this?
